75975 is a 5-digit zip code located in Timpson, Texas. Timpson is the primary city for 75975 and is located in Shelby. In the most recent US census the population of 75975 was 3373.

There are a total of 1,683 housing units in 75975, Texas. A total of 27.09% (456) are currently vacant.
